The Federal government has assigned various identifying codes to each community, county and state. At one time or another, the US Census Bureau has used one (or more) of the following identifiers when referring to either Campbell County or the community of Sleepy Hollow:
- The GNIS Codes ...
- The current system of identification is called the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S). The following GNIS codes relate to Sleepy Hollow:
- GNIS ID for Sleepy Hollow: 1674979
- GNIS ID for Campbell County: 1674917
- GNIS ID for State of Virginia: 1779803
- Misc. Census Codes ...
- Sleepy Hollow is located in Census Region #3 (the South Region) and Division #5 (the South Atlantic Division).
